#d53908 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d53908 is composed of 83.5% red, 22.4%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 73.2% magenta, 96.2%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 14.3 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 43.3%. #d53908 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ff7210 with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#d53908
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050100 is the darkest color, while #fef4f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d53908
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6e6e is the less saturated color, while #d53908 is the most saturated one.
